El 80% de las consultas comerciales en PYMES peruanas entran por WhatsApp, pero el 80% del histórico de ventas vive en Odoo. Si esos dos mundos no están conectados, tu equipo se quema copiando datos a mano — y los clientes se enfrían esperando respuesta. Esta es la guía técnica y operativa para integrar WhatsApp Business API con Odoo en una empresa peruana, sin Excel intermedio.
En Lima, Arequipa, Trujillo y la mayoría del interior del país, el patrón es el mismo: la primera conversación con un cliente nuevo nace en WhatsApp. La cotización se manda por WhatsApp. La confirmación de cita o pedido se cierra por WhatsApp. Y cuando la persona compra, alguien — humano, normalmente sobrepasado — copia los datos del chat al CRM de Odoo. Cuando hay 30 conversaciones al día, eso funciona. Cuando son 300, no.
Integrar WhatsApp Business API con Odoo ERP no es solo una mejora técnica: es la diferencia entre escalar tu operación con el equipo que tienes, o tener que contratar tres personas más solo para no perder mensajes. En esta guía vas a encontrar la arquitectura real, qué proveedor elegir, qué flujos automatizar primero y los errores específicos que vemos repetirse en empresas peruanas.
WhatsApp Business vs WhatsApp Business API: lo que tienes que saber primero
El error más común al empezar este proyecto es confundir WhatsApp Business (la app gratuita) con WhatsApp Business API (la versión empresarial). Para conectar con Odoo necesitas obligatoriamente la API. Esta es la diferencia real:
| Característica | WhatsApp Business (app) | WhatsApp Business API |
|---|---|---|
| Costo | Gratis | Por conversación iniciada |
| Múltiples agentes | No | Sí, ilimitados |
| Bots e IA conversacional | No oficial | Sí, soporte nativo |
| Integración con Odoo / CRM | Solo manual | Vía webhooks y API |
| Mensajes masivos / campañas | No, te banea | Sí, con plantillas HSM |
| Sincroniza con base de clientes | No | Sí, bidireccional |
| Verificación de empresa (tilde verde) | Limitada | Sí, oficial |
Si todavía estás usando WhatsApp Business app con varios celulares pasando entre vendedores, esa es la primera señal de que tu empresa ya necesita migrar a WhatsApp Business API. No solo por eficiencia: si Meta detecta automatización no autorizada en una cuenta personal o de Business app, te suspenden el número definitivamente.
Arquitectura real de la integración WhatsApp + Odoo
Esta es la arquitectura que estamos implementando para PYMES peruanas. Cada bloque tiene una responsabilidad clara y se puede sustituir sin romper el resto:
┌────────────────────────────────────────────────────────────────────┐ │ │ │ 📱 Cliente │ │ ─────── │ │ │ envía mensaje │ │ ▼ │ │ ☁️ WhatsApp Cloud API (Meta / BSP) │ │ │ webhook HTTPS │ │ ▼ │ │ 🔁 Capa de orquestación (n8n / FastAPI / Make) │ │ │ │ │ │ ┌──── lee/escribe stock, leads, cotizaciones ─┐ │ │ │ │ │ │ │ ▼ ▼ │ │ │ 🤖 Agente IA 🏢 Odoo ERP 💳 Culqi / Izipay │ │ (Claude / GPT-4o) (Community, en tu (links de pago) │ │ propio servidor) │ │ │ └────────────────────────────────────────────────────────────────────┘
Cada pieza cumple un rol específico:
- Capa de WhatsApp (BSP): recibe los mensajes del cliente y dispara un webhook a tu servidor. Puede ser Cloud API de Meta (directo) o un BSP intermedio como 360dialog, Twilio o Wati.
- Orquestador: recibe el webhook, decide qué hacer con el mensaje, consulta Odoo, llama al modelo de IA si es necesario y responde. Acá vive la lógica de tu negocio. n8n es la opción más popular en empresas peruanas por ser self-hosted y dueño total de los datos.
- Agente de IA: Claude o GPT-4o procesa el mensaje en lenguaje natural, extrae la intención (cotización, agendamiento, queja, consulta de estado) y devuelve una respuesta o una acción a ejecutar.
- Odoo ERP: la "fuente de verdad" de tu empresa. Acá viven los clientes (res.partner), las oportunidades (crm.lead), los productos (product.product) y los pagos. El orquestador lee y escribe directamente vía Odoo API JSON-RPC o XML-RPC.
- Pasarela de pago: Culqi, Izipay, Niubiz o Mercado Pago. El orquestador genera un link de pago cuando el cliente confirma la compra y lo envía al chat. Cuando se confirma el pago, escribe la factura en Odoo.
Por qué Odoo Community y no Online en este caso
Para integraciones avanzadas con WhatsApp y agentes de IA conviene fuertemente Odoo Community auto-hospedado. Tienes acceso directo al modelo de datos, instalas módulos OCA gratuitos, evitas la licencia por usuario y, sobre todo, los datos de tus clientes nunca salen del servidor que tú controlas. Esto es importante por la Ley 29733 de Protección de Datos Personales en Perú.
Elegir proveedor de WhatsApp Business API en Perú: las 4 opciones reales
El mercado de proveedores (BSP, Business Solution Providers) cambió mucho desde que Meta lanzó Cloud API directo en 2022. Estas son las 4 opciones que tiene una empresa peruana en 2026:
1. Meta Cloud API (directo)
Es la opción más barata por conversación, pagas a Meta directamente. La cuenta se administra desde Business Manager de Facebook. Requiere más trabajo técnico inicial pero te da el control total. Recomendado para empresas con equipo técnico interno o que ya trabajan con un implementador especializado.
2. 360dialog
BSP alemán, uno de los oficiales de Meta. Bueno por estabilidad y precios competitivos. Soporte en inglés y alemán principalmente. Cobran un fee mensual fijo más el costo por conversación. Ideal para empresas que valoran estabilidad y no quieren depender de un BSP local.
3. Twilio
El más conocido a nivel global. Documentación impecable, SDK en todos los lenguajes. Precio por conversación más alto que Meta directo pero la confiabilidad es de las mejores. Recomendado si ya usas Twilio para SMS o voz.
4. Wati / Whaticket / proveedores locales
BSPs intermedios con UI propia (panel para que tu equipo administre conversaciones sin código). Más caros, pero más rápidos de poner en marcha. Buena opción si no quieres armar tu propio panel y necesitas que el equipo comercial use una bandeja unificada.
| Si tu empresa... | Te conviene |
|---|---|
| Tiene volumen alto (10K+ conversaciones/mes) y equipo técnico | Meta Cloud API directo |
| Empieza, no quiere lidiar con setup técnico | 360dialog o Wati |
| Ya usa Twilio para SMS o voz | Twilio |
| Quiere panel listo para usar y bandeja compartida del equipo | Wati o similar local |
Los 5 flujos que toda PYME peruana debe automatizar primero
Estos son los flujos que más impacto tienen en los primeros 90 días de la integración WhatsApp + Odoo. Los ordenamos por velocidad de retorno:
Flujo 1: Captura automática de leads desde WhatsApp a Odoo CRM
Cuando un cliente nuevo escribe a tu WhatsApp, el agente de IA hace 3-4 preguntas básicas (nombre, empresa o necesidad, presupuesto aproximado, urgencia) y crea automáticamente una oportunidad (crm.lead) en Odoo con toda esa información estructurada. Tu equipo comercial deja de escarbar conversaciones para entender qué quería el lead.
Flujo 2: Cotizaciones automáticas con consulta de stock real
El cliente pide un producto. El agente IA identifica el producto en tu catálogo Odoo (product.product), verifica stock en tiempo real, calcula precio + IGV, genera la cotización PDF y la envía al chat. Si confirma, crea la sale.order automáticamente.
Flujo 3: Recordatorios de citas, pagos y vencimientos
Con plantillas HSM aprobadas, envías recordatorios outbound: "Hola María, te recuerdo tu cita mañana 10am en Mirela Ferro Studio. ¿Confirmas?". Si el cliente dice "no", el agente libera el bloque en Google Calendar y notifica a Odoo. Reduce no-shows entre 40% y 60%.
Flujo 4: Cobranza automática post-venta
Cuando Odoo detecta una factura vencida, dispara un workflow que envía mensaje al cliente con el detalle y el link de pago Culqi o Izipay. Si paga, Odoo registra la cobranza y cierra el ciclo. Esto suele liberar entre 8 y 14 horas semanales del equipo administrativo en estudios contables, escuelas privadas y empresas de servicios recurrentes.
Flujo 5: Notificaciones de estado de pedido / envío
Conectado con tu proveedor logístico, el agente notifica al cliente cuando su pedido sale del almacén, está en camino y fue entregado. Las consultas tipo "¿llegó mi pedido?" caen al casi cero, liberando al equipo de soporte para casos reales.
Errores comunes al integrar WhatsApp con Odoo (y cómo evitarlos)
Después de ver decenas de implementaciones en empresas peruanas, estos son los errores que más se repiten:
Error #1: Lanzar el agente sin supervisión humana las primeras 2 semanas
Un agente IA recién desplegado va a equivocarse. Si no tienes un canal donde un humano revise sus respuestas antes de mandarlas, las primeras 100 conversaciones pueden dañar tu marca. La buena práctica es "human-in-the-loop" decreciente: 100% supervisión la primera semana, 50% la segunda, 20% la tercera y autonomía total recién al mes.
Error #2: No definir el tono de marca del bot
El agente IA tiene que sonar como tu empresa, no como ChatGPT. Si tu marca es informal-cercana, no puede mandar respuestas con "Estimado cliente, hemos recibido su solicitud...". Define el tono explícitamente en el prompt del agente y dale ejemplos reales de conversaciones de tu equipo.
Error #3: Mezclar la base de clientes de WhatsApp con la de Odoo sin reglas claras
Cuando un cliente nuevo escribe, ¿se crea un nuevo registro res.partner o se busca por teléfono y se actualiza el existente? ¿Qué pasa si el teléfono coincide pero el nombre es distinto? Define estas reglas antes de lanzar, o terminarás con duplicados que ensucian tu CRM.
Error #4: No aprovechar las plantillas HSM
Muchas integraciones se limitan a responder, pero el verdadero ROI está en los mensajes outbound (campañas, recordatorios, cobranza). Sí, las plantillas HSM tienen que pasar revisión de Meta, pero una vez aprobadas son tu canal más efectivo para reactivar clientes dormidos.
Error #5: No medir nada
Tu integración tiene que reportar: cuántos mensajes entrantes, cuántos resueltos por el bot, cuántos derivados a humano, tiempo promedio de respuesta, conversión a cotización, conversión a venta. Sin métricas no sabes si la integración está pagando lo que cuesta.
Advertencia: la Ley 29733 sí aplica
Si tu agente IA guarda historial de conversaciones para "memoria" o entrenamiento, estás procesando datos personales según la Ley 29733. Eso significa: aviso de privacidad visible, posibilidad de borrado a solicitud y servidor preferentemente en Perú o con cláusulas de transferencia internacional. Esto no es opcional. Las multas para PYMES llegan hasta 50 UIT.
Cómo medir el ROI de la integración WhatsApp + Odoo
Las 6 métricas que tu integración debe poder reportar desde el primer día:
- Tiempo promedio de primera respuesta: antes era 2-4 horas, con integración debe bajar a menos de 30 segundos.
- Tasa de resolución sin humano: qué porcentaje de conversaciones cierra el bot solo. Un buen target es 70-90% en el segundo mes.
- Leads creados en Odoo CRM por día: deberías ver un aumento de 30-50% solo por capturar los que antes se perdían.
- Tasa de conversión lead → cotización: con bot que pre-califica, sube entre 25% y 40%.
- No-shows en citas: con recordatorios automáticos baja entre 40% y 60%.
- Horas semanales del equipo recuperadas: el dato más importante para el dueño. Suele estar entre 15 y 35 horas/semana para PYMES de 5-20 empleados.
Preguntas frecuentes sobre WhatsApp + Odoo en Perú
¿Necesito tener Odoo ya implementado antes de integrar WhatsApp?
¿La integración funciona con Odoo Community o solo con Enterprise?
¿Puedo mantener mi número de WhatsApp actual?
¿El bot puede pasar la conversación a un humano cuando es necesario?
¿Qué pasa si Meta cambia las reglas o suspende mi cuenta?
¿Puedo enviar mensajes masivos con esta integración?
¿Quieres una integración WhatsApp + Odoo a medida?
Diagnóstico gratuito de 60 minutos. Vemos tus flujos actuales y armamos la propuesta técnica con plazos y arquitectura — sin compromiso.


